The following are conditions that may cause the malfunction:
- A short to ground or voltage in the SIS circuit
- High or low resistance in the SIS circuit
- Improper SIS installed on vehicle
Thoroughly inspect the wiring and the connectors. An incomplete inspection of the wiring and connectors may result in misdiagnosis, causing a part replacement with the reappearance of the malfunction. If an intermittent malfunction exists, refer to TESTING FOR INTERMITTENT AND POOR CONNECTIONS .
